By Lainie Petersen Updated October 26, 2018 Bail bond firms help individuals who have actually been charged with criminal offenses live outside of jail legally while waiting for trial. State regulations regulate bail bond business, and the policies can be rather complex. Business owners who might think about getting right into this business ought to know that there is a solid trend among protestor and legal groups to advocate the elimination or decrease of cash money bail needs in the court system, which may make bail bond companies out-of-date.


In some situations, the charged may be launched on his or her very own recognizance, which indicates that the court depends on the private to appear for the following court date and to abide with all conditions set by the judge, such as working or avoiding making use of alcohol.

The bail bond business offers the implicated a surety bond, which acts as insurance coverage that the accused will certainly reveal up in court when gotten to do so. People who own a bail bond firm are occasionally recognized as bondsman. The cost of the prison bond is typically a percentage of the bail.

Additionally, the bail bond company may call for the implicated to secure the bond with security, such as the deed to a residence, or a vehicle, jewelry or other belongings. A good friend or household participant of the implicated may concur to install collateral to safeguard the bond. From there, the bail bond company sends out a representative to the court to pay a section of the bail and warranty settlement of the rest should the accused not appear when called for to do so.

The percentage paid by the client is not gone back to him but is gathered as the charge for the bond itself. This is why some legal consultants recommend that customers try to prevent utilizing a bond service whenever possible. Lawyers will often try to collaborate with judges to minimize the quantity of bail to ensure that the accused and his family are not called for to pay what can be a huge quantity of cash that they will never return.


Some customers fall short to do so. When this takes place, bail bond firm proprietors are equipped by law to nail their customers and bring them to court. Customers are commonly fetched by specialist bond enforcement agents, often recognized as bounty seekers, who are learnt tracking down and safely apprehending fugitives.

The procedure of becoming a bondsman is various for each state, but commonly needs a private to finish an authorized training program, go through a history check and acquire a surety bond.


It should be kept in mind that states manage both process web servers and exclusive investigators, so people offering either or both services might need to acquire a separate specialist permit for each and every trade. Bail bond solution proprietors need to investigate the legislation in their states to discover what sort of licensing needs they'll have to fulfill.
